The Private Tour Experience and Transportation
Starting with the fact that it’s a private tour, this means you’ll have a dedicated guide and vehicle—an open-jeep that’s perfect for city sightseeing. This setup offers a relaxed vibe, allowing you to hop on and off at your own pace, and it’s especially good for those who want to avoid the crowded group tours. The guide, who speaks fluent English, is there to enrich your experience with facts and stories about the sights, making the evening more engaging.
The timing of the tour is flexible but is recommended based on sunset times and your hotel’s location. The vehicle can accommodate between 1 to 12 people, with the number of jeeps adjusted accordingly. For smaller groups of 1-4, just one jeep is needed, but larger groups are easily managed with multiple jeeps. The tour includes all transfers, parking, and fuel, so no unexpected costs to worry about.

The Showstoppers: Nahargarh Fort and Sunset
Perched atop the rugged Aravalli Hills, Nahargarh Fort offers the city’s most breathtaking sunset view. Imagine watching Jaipur’s sprawling rooftops shimmering beneath a fiery sky—this is the highlight that many visitors remember. As night falls, the city lights flicker on, transforming the landscape into a glittering mosaic. One reviewer described it as “a sight that must be experienced firsthand.”
Amber Fort is another notable stop. Though it’s off-limits now for interior exploration, the fort’s exterior is bathed in soft yellow lights and moonlight, making it a perfect photo spot. You might find, as one reviewer did, that seeing Amber Fort lit up in the evening adds a different dimension to its usual grandeur.

Other sites like Hawa Mahal and Jal Mahal are illuminated beautifully in the night. The Hawa Mahal, with its honeycomb façade, looks especially stunning under the night lights, shimmering like a jewel. Though you won’t go inside these monuments, the external glow creates excellent photo opportunities and a sense of Jaipur’s vibrant nightlife.
After the main sightseeing, the tour includes time to explore local markets—full of lively stalls, street food vendors, and traditional sweets. This is where you can try the famed yogurt-based beverage or enjoy a local snack, just as one reviewer noted about their stop for masala chai next to the fire pit.

FAQ

Is this tour suitable for all ages?
Yes, as long as infants can sit on laps, the tour is appropriate for most ages. Just check with the provider if you have special needs.
What is included in the price?
The tour fee covers hotel pickup and drop-off, all transfers by private open-jeep, a knowledgeable English-speaking guide, parking, fuel, bottled water, and a tea/coffee stop.
Are entry fees for monuments included?
No, entry fees for Nahargarh Fort are not included, but you can enjoy external views and the sunset without additional cost.
How flexible are the departure times?
The start time varies depending on sunset times and your hotel location. The provider will advise you after booking.
Can I customize the tour?
While the itinerary is generally fixed, the guide can offer suggestions based on your preferences or weather conditions.
What if the weather isn’t clear?
The guide will suggest alternative viewpoints or activities if the weather prevents a good sunset or visibility.
How many people can join?
The tour can accommodate from 1 to 12 people, with additional jeeps arranged for larger groups.
Is food included?
No, meals are not included, but you will have opportunities to taste local street food and sweets during the stops.
Will I see inside the monuments?
No, the experience focuses on external views and lighting, offering a different perspective from daytime visits.
